Understanding CROs
CROs are specialized companies that provide a wide range of research and development services to pharmaceutical, biotechnology, and medical device companies. These services can include clinical trials, data management, regulatory affairs, and more. By outsourcing these tasks to CROs, companies can focus on their core competencies and accelerate the drug development process.
The Role of CROs in Drug Development
CROs play a vital role in the drug development process. They help companies navigate the complexities of clinical trials, ensuring that studies are conducted efficiently and effectively. This includes designing and implementing study protocols, recruiting and managing study participants, and collecting and analyzing data. By leveraging the expertise of CROs, companies can bring new drugs to market faster and more cost-effectively.
Services Offered by CROs
CROs offer a diverse range of services to support drug development. Here are some of the key services provided by CROs:
Service | Description |
---|---|
Clinical Trials | Designing, conducting, and managing clinical trials to test the safety and efficacy of new drugs. |
Data Management | Collecting, organizing, and analyzing data from clinical trials to ensure accuracy and compliance with regulatory requirements. |
Regulatory Affairs | Assisting companies with the regulatory approval process, including preparing and submitting applications to regulatory agencies. |
Biostatistics | Providing statistical analysis and support for clinical trials, helping to ensure the validity of study results. |
Medical Writing | Producing high-quality documents, such as clinical study reports and regulatory submissions. |
The Benefits of Working with CROs
There are several benefits to working with CROs, including:
-
Cost savings: Outsourcing certain tasks to CROs can help companies reduce their operational costs.
-
Expertise: CROs have specialized knowledge and experience in drug development, which can help companies navigate the complexities of the process.
-
Speed: CROs can help accelerate the drug development process, bringing new drugs to market faster.
-
Flexibility: CROs can provide a range of services, allowing companies to choose the ones that best meet their needs.
The CRO Market
The CRO market has been growing steadily over the past few years, driven by the increasing demand for new drugs and the need for companies to streamline their drug development processes. According to a report by Grand View Research, the global CRO market is expected to reach $100 billion by 2025.
